DC’s Supergirl Is A Streaming Success After Bombing At The Box Office

Milly Alcock as Supergirl flying

Supergirl may have majorly underperformed at the box office, but it’s doing big numbers on streaming. The latest movie in the DC Universe recently made its debut on HBO Max. It turns out, audiences were pretty curious to check out Milly Alcock’s solo debut as the Girl of Steel. It quickly became a major hit for the streaming service. 

 

As of this writing, Supergirl is the number one movie on HBO Max. It’s earned more than twice as much viewing as the next-biggest movie on the platform. That movie is Practical Magic, which people are catching up with thanks to Practical Magic 2 now being in theaters. Whether or not the streaming success is enough to make up for the lackluster performance remains to be seen. At the very least, it’s an impressive consolation prize. 

 

To say that the new Supergirl movie was a disappointment commercially would be an understatement. Against a huge $170 million budget, it made just $126 million at the box office. It was also met with mixed reviews from critics. Warner Bros. and DC Studios had very high hopes ahead of release. It was the follow-up to last summer’s Superman, which kicked off the new DCU on a successful note. It didn’t go as well as everyone had hoped. 

 

Here is the synopsis for Supergirl. 

 

“When an unexpected and ruthless adversary strikes too close to home, Kara Zor-El, aka Supergirl, reluctantly joins forces with an unlikely companion on an epic, interstellar journey of vengeance and justice.” 

 

The cast also includes Eve Ridley as Ruthye Marye Knoll, Matthias Schoenaerts as Krem of the Yellow Hills, David Krumholtz as Zor-El, Emily Beecham as Alura In-Ze and Ferdinand Kingsley as Elias Knoll. Craig Gillespie (Cruella, Dumb Money) directed the movie. 

 

Alcock’s Supergirl is expected to be a big part of the new DCU. She’s part of the cast of director James Gunn’s Man of Tomorrow, which is due to hit theaters next summer. So, even though the movie bombed at the box office, it’s undoubtedly encouraging for WB and DC to see it finding success on HBO Max. At the very least, audiences will be more familiar with her character, even if it wasn’t through ticket sales. 

 

Looking ahead, next month will see the release of the R-rated Clayface movie. It’s a lower budget movie based on the Batman villain of the same name. That means there is less pressure on it to perform. Beyond that, there are several movies in development including a new Wonder Woman, The Brave and the Bold and Teen Titans, among others.
